Output e826c535af184e1d8740eab82ba9e47a7042bb1aa877c2fce817bf5925d72e04:1

value
6983554814858
script pubkey
OP_0 OP_PUSHBYTES_20 4d7e30d96339f51b454386c093cbdca638090cc3
address
tb1qf4lrpktr8863k32rsmqf8j7u5cuqjrxrjcxgv2
transaction
e826c535af184e1d8740eab82ba9e47a7042bb1aa877c2fce817bf5925d72e04
confirmations
170769
spent
true